However the source code for this file must still be made available// in accordance with section (3) of the GNU General Public License.//// This exception does not invalidate any other reasons why a work based on// this file might be covered by the GNU General Public License.//// Alternative licenses for eCos may be arranged by contacting Red Hat, Inc.// at http://sources.redhat.com/ecos/ecos-license/// -------------------------------------------//####ECOSGPLCOPYRIGHTEND####//==========================================================================//#####DESCRIPTIONBEGIN####//// Author(s): jlarmour// Contributors: // Date: 2000-06-12// Purpose: Shared definitions used by memory allocators// Description: // Usage: #include <cyg/memalloc/common.hxx>// ////####DESCRIPTIONEND####////========================================================================*//* CONFIGURATION */#include <pkgconf/memalloc.h>/* TYPE DEFINITIONS */// struct Cyg_Mempool_Status is returned by the get_status() method of// standard eCos memory allocators. After return from get_status(), any// field of type T may be set to ((T)-1) to indicate that the information// is not available or not applicable to this allocator.class Cyg_Mempool_Status {public: const cyg_uint8 *arenabase; // base address of entire pool cyg_int32 arenasize; // total size of entire pool cyg_int32 freeblocks; // number of chunks free for use cyg_int32 totalallocated; // total allocated space in bytes cyg_int32 totalfree; // total space in bytes not in use cyg_int32 blocksize; // block size if fixed block cyg_int32 maxfree; // size of largest unused block cyg_int8 waiting; // are there any threads waiting for memory? const cyg_uint8 *origbase; // address of original region used when pool // created cyg_int32 origsize; // size of original region used when pool // created // maxoverhead is the *maximum* per-allocation overhead imposed by // the allocator implementation. Note: this is rarely the typical // overhead which often depends on the size of the allocation requested. // It includes overhead due to alignment constraints. For example, if // maxfree and maxoverhead are available for this allocator, then an // allocation request of (maxfree-maxoverhead) bytes must always succeed // Unless maxoverhead is set to -1 of course, in which case the allocator // does not support reporting this information. cyg_int8 maxoverhead; void init() { arenabase = (const cyg_uint8 *)-1; arenasize = -1; freeblocks = -1; totalallocated = -1; totalfree = -1; blocksize = -1; maxfree = -1; waiting = -1; origbase = (const cyg_uint8 *)-1; origsize = -1; maxoverhead = -1; } // constructor Cyg_Mempool_Status() { init(); }};// Flags to pass to get_status() methods to tell it which stat(s) is/are// being requested#define CYG_MEMPOOL_STAT_ARENABASE (1<<0)#define CYG_MEMPOOL_STAT_ARENASIZE (1<<1)#define CYG_MEMPOOL_STAT_FREEBLOCKS (1<<2)#define CYG_MEMPOOL_STAT_TOTALALLOCATED (1<<3)#define CYG_MEMPOOL_STAT_TOTALFREE (1<<4)#define CYG_MEMPOOL_STAT_BLOCKSIZE (1<<5)#define CYG_MEMPOOL_STAT_MAXFREE (1<<6)#define CYG_MEMPOOL_STAT_WAITING (1<<7)#define CYG_MEMPOOL_STAT_ORIGBASE (1<<9)#define CYG_MEMPOOL_STAT_ORIGSIZE (1<<10)#define CYG_MEMPOOL_STAT_MAXOVERHEAD (1<<11)// And an opaque type for any arguments with these flagstypedef cyg_uint16 cyg_mempool_status_flag_t;#endif /* ifndef CYGONCE_MEMALLOC_COMMON_HXX *//* EOF common.hxx */
